  • Hi all today I wanted to share this incredible community I've called home for some time called The Grove in College, Grove, TN. This is an insane 12 phase 1,100 acre development that has been growing since around 2012. It's entering its final development phases now, and it's turned into one of the most incredible neighborhoods I've seen.
    Located just outside Nashville and only minutes from historic Franklin, Tennessee, lies a private club community unlike any other. The Grove is a 1,100-acre gated community offering a distinctive lifestyle dedicated to providing exceptional member services and the most comprehensive amenity and recreational offerings in the region. There is a clubhouse, full gym, three pools, dog park, soccer fields, hiking trails, tennis courts, bar/restaurant, full 18-course golf course, sports center, and more.
    The Grove features luxury estate homes created from a rich, thoughtful palette of classic architectural styles, exquisite detailing, and signature elements. Truly every single home is different, a true custom home, including mine.
    The scenic landscape of rolling hills, woodlands, parks, and preserved open space serves as the ideal backdrop for the most luxurious, new custom homes Nashville has to offer.
    Custom homes from $1.2 million to $3 million and custom homesites from $190,000 to over $400,000.
